For her asthma and heart murmur, Avida takes two puffs twice a day from a flovent inhaler and is also on a natural anti-inflammatory once a day. Though she coughs intermittently, she’s doing well on her inhaler and knows how to convey that an asthma attack is coming. In addition, Avida has also had about 75-80% of her teeth extracted.
Avida will need medical care and treatment for the rest of her life which should be long and happy as long as she doesn’t have a life-threatening asthma attack. Avida lives in a caring foster home and is a very loveable cat. None of her illnesses stop her from being a frisky little kitty, and the Animal League is happy to care for all of her needs.
